The ingredients needed to make Vegetarian/Vegan Bolognese:
  1. Take 1 small head of cauliflower
  2. Get 1 lb mushrooms, I prefer a wild mix
  3. Make ready 2 cups carrots, shredded or whole
  4. Prepare 1 small yellow onion
  5. Take 4 tbsp garlic
  6. Get 2 tbsp crushed red pepper
  7. Prepare 1 tbsp dry basil
  8. Take 1 tbsp dry thyme
  9. Take 2 tbsp sugar
  10. Get 4 cans (28 oz) crushed tomatoes
  11. Take 1 cup red wine
  12. Get 1/2 cup Olive oil
  13. Get to taste Salt and pepper

Steps to make Vegetarian/Vegan Bolognese:
  1. Rough chop your cauliflower, carrots,onions and mushrooms.
  2. Add your vegetable mix and garlic in a blender or food processor and pulse until finely chopped (essentially looks like ground beef)
  3. In a pot heat up about 1/2 cup of oil.
  4. Add your vegetable mix, herbs and spices and saute until they soften.
  5. Add your red wine and reduce by 1/2.
  6. Add your tomatoes and sugar and simmer for about 35/40 mins
  7. Serve with your favorite pasta and enjoy!
